Global Warming Effects in Latvia: A Closer Look

Located in Northern Europe, Latvia is a country rich in natural beauty, with its diverse landscapes that include forests, lakes, and stunning coastline along the Baltic Sea. However, like many other regions around the world, Latvia is not immune to the effects of global warming. One of the most significant impacts of global warming in Latvia is the changing climate patterns. Winters have become milder, with less snowfall and shorter periods of freezing temperatures. This affects various aspects of life in Latvia, from the winter tourism industry to agriculture and wildlife habitats. Rising temperatures also contribute to the melting of glaciers and ice caps, which in turn leads to rising sea levels. In Latvia, this poses a threat to coastal areas, including the vibrant city of Riga, which could be at risk of flooding in the future. Another consequence of global warming in Latvia is the disruption of ecosystems and biodiversity. Changing temperatures and weather patterns can lead to shifts in plant and animal populations, affecting the delicate balance of ecosystems in the country. This can have a cascading effect on the entire food chain, potentially leading to the loss of some species and the introduction of new ones. Furthermore, global warming can exacerbate natural disasters such as floods and wildfires. Extreme weather events have become more frequent and intense in Latvia, causing damage to infrastructure, agriculture, and the environment. These events can have long-lasting effects on communities and the economy, requiring significant resources for recovery and resilience building. In response to the challenges posed by global warming, Latvia has been taking steps to mitigate its impact and transition to a more sustainable future. The country has been investing in renewable energy sources, such as wind and solar power, to reduce its carbon footprint and dependence on fossil fuels. Additionally, efforts are being made to raise awareness about climate change and encourage individuals and businesses to adopt eco-friendly practices. While the effects of global warming in Latvia are evident, there is still hope for a better future.
